    Default Tech support

    Last year I purchased the Xara Suite but never used it - did open all three programs and looked at them.

    I now want to design another web site but have some problems -

    1- Webstyle comes up with an error message: Problem with templ0p.dll
    2- Xara 3D6 comes up with: Failed, no image, undo changes.

    I have un-stalled and re-installed both programs and same results.

    The ONLY way I have found to get tech support is to send a "ticket", which I did. SEVERAL days later received a reply ref. Webstyle and followed their instructions and still doesn't work.

    No reply on 3D as yet - maybe after a week???

    I looked at the new Extreme Pro and am thinking about buying it but I keep asking myself, "Why do I want to spend more money with a company for which 2/3 of their programs I can't use and has virtually NO tech support?"

    When one is working with a project and has a problem, having to wait maybe several weeks to get the problem resolved is just not acceptable - too bad, when they work the program is great. - jeb
